Remediation of multiple heavy metal-contaminated soil through the combination of soil washing and in situ immobilization

The remediation of heavy metal-contaminated soils is a great challenge for global
environmental sciences and engineering. To control the ecological risks of heavy metal-
contaminated soil more effectively, the present study focused on the combination of soil
washing (with FeCl 3) and in situ immobilization (with lime, biochar, and black carbon). The
results showed that the removal rate of Cd, Pb, Zn, and Cu was 62.9%, 52.1%, 30.0%, and
